Precision Starts with Understanding the Workflow

Every steel facility operates differently. Some process wide steel sheets, others handle narrow coils; some have overhead cranes, others rely on forklifts. Off-the-shelf solutions can’t account for these differences.

GLT Muhendislik begins each project by mapping the complete material movement path within the plant. This ensures that the storage design supports—not hinders—daily operations. From aisle width to coil orientation, each detail is considered.
